A debate is a planned discussion among people who have different opinions. Each team is given a topic and allowed to present their arguments. The affirmative side will argue in favor of the resolution while the opposite side will argue against it. The first speaker of each team is then next followed by the other speaker. Then, the second affirmative speaker responds with an argument to counter the argument of the opposition.
